i installed over my 3.0.x installs on redhat using the freshen command. it appears that it didn't preserve the autostarting of the service. otherwise, seems to work fine. I normally tar up the whole thing before hand just to make sure :) On Tue, Mar 18, 2008 at 11:22 AM, Kelly, Jim <Jim_Kelly@sra.com> wrote:
Hello all I've been poking around the nessus direct feed site looking for an instruction set on how to upgrade Nessus 3.0 to 3.2 on Debian. I was thinking I'd just run the install on 3.2, blowing the new in over the old and then redo my registration/activation code. Does anyone have a better plan than this?
